Discrepancies in patient and caregiver ratings of personality change in Alzheimer’s disease and related dementias

2023-03-13

Abstract excerpt

<h4>Background</h4> Assessment of personality change in Alzheimer’s disease and related dementias (ADRD) is clinically meaningful but complicated by patient (i.e., reduced insight) and informant (i.e., caregiver burden) factors that confound accurate reporting of personality traits.
